-{Acorn template blog hop PCS}-

Welcome to the PCS blog hop, and a special "hi" if you have come from Wendy's blog {here}

This month's template from the Paper Crafters Sampler is to make a shaped pocket to put a gift in (you can purchase it {here}. The original template is to make an acorn shape, however I had a play and came up with this strawberry.


The template is really easy to use, just print it out on the wrong side of the patterned paper or cardstock, cut it out, decorate and stick together.  I used the Square Lattice Folder to give it some texture, and cut leaves from the Leaves Sizzix die (which is retiring this month).  The flower is made from the 5 petal flower punch (also retiring) and the centre from the Boho Blossom punch. I added the seeds with the white gel pen from Stampin' Up!

-{honoured and inspired}-

A few weeks ago Melanie Schulenberg of Pockets of Inspiration blog asked me to join Creative Take design team for the Paper Crafters Sampler (PCS).  The PCS is a monthly online magazine for Stampin' Up! customers and demonstrators packed full of ideas and inspiration using SU products.  Included in the magazine is a template to make a 3D object designed by Melanie.  My role is to have a play with the template and make something to inspire different uses of it.  I feel very honoured to have been asked and look forward to lots of inspiration and hopefully being able to inspire you.

The template in the issue is to make a ink well holder - so my job was to see what else it could be used for.  So I've created a little gift box for a nail gift set.  There is enough room for a small bottle of nail varnish, some varnish remover, cotton buds and nail files.




The paper I have used is from the currently available (until stocks last) Everyday Enchantment.
